Default Embedding Excel Object in Word Document Failing


When I embed an excel object (a financial statement) into a word document, it works fine the first time I do it. I select and copy in the excel file and Paste Special > Link > Excel Object in the word file.

The very first time I do that process and print, everything is aligned as it should be and the gridlines from excel (which are not turned on to print in excel) do NOT show up in my word document.

However, if I save and close the word file and reopen...I first get a message about updating the links, which I do. Then if I try and print that same exact file, the gridlines from the excel document (which are still not turned on to print and which are not borders) print. The only way I can fix the problem is to delete the linked object and recopy and paste special, etc.

Any ideas about how to fix this bug?
